Commercial Foundation Repair in Columbus, OH
Commercial foundation repair services address issues related to the stability and integrity of a building's foundation. These projects typically involve residential or commercial properties experiencing settlement, cracking, or shifting that can compromise structural safety. Property owners often request these services when signs such as uneven flooring, cracked walls, or sticking doors and windows appear, indicating potential foundation problems. The scope of repairs can include underpinning, pier and beam stabilization, slab lifting, or crack repair, all aimed at restoring the foundation’s strength and preventing further damage.
Before requesting foundation repair services, property owners usually want to understand the extent of the foundation issues and the most appropriate solutions. It’s important to assess whether the damage is localized or widespread and to consider the underlying causes, such as soil movement or moisture problems. Clear communication about the repair process, potential impacts on the property, and expected outcomes can help property owners make informed decisions. Proper evaluation and timely intervention can help maintain the safety and value of the property over time.

Common Commercial Foundation Repair Jobs
Commercial foundation repair involves stabilizing and strengthening building foundations to prevent structural issues.
Settlement correction addresses uneven sinking of commercial structures to restore stability.
Crack repair involves sealing and reinforcing foundation cracks to prevent further damage.
Pier and beam repair focuses on supporting and leveling commercial buildings with pier systems.
Soil stabilization improves the ground beneath foundations to reduce shifting and settling.
Waterproofing services help protect foundations from water intrusion and related damage.
Commercial Foundation Repair Questions
What are common signs of foundation issues in commercial properties? Visible cracks, uneven flooring, and doors or windows that stick may indicate foundation problems needing assessment.
How does foundation damage affect a commercial building? It can lead to structural instability, costly repairs, and potential safety concerns if not addressed promptly.
What types of foundation repair methods are typically used? Techniques such as piering, underpinning, and stabilization are common to restore foundation support and integrity.
Why is early inspection important for foundation concerns? Early detection can prevent minor issues from becoming major, reducing repair costs and minimizing disruption.
